Steps: Update Matching Rule Sets with AI Suggestions
Set up AI Bank Reconciliation: Rule Orchestrator. See Steps: Set Up AI Bank Reconciliation.
For bank accounts where you enable AI Bank Reconciliation: Rule Orchestrator, you can:
- Generate new matching rule suggestions.
- Accept, edit, or reject AI-suggested matching rules.
When you accept suggestions, Workday prompts you to add them to a matching rule set.
- Access 1 of these tasks:
- Run AI Matching Rule Suggestion
- Schedule AI Matching Rule Suggestion

- Access theReview AI Suggested Matching Rulestask.ThePotential Matched Transactionscount for a rule indicates the number of bank statement lines that you could have automatically matched in the past 12 months with this rule.
- In theReconciliation Rulecolumn, click a matching rule.
- (Optional) Review theHistorical Matchestab.The tab displays the historical reconciliation data that you could have automatically matched in the past 12 months with this rule.
- Complete theRule Detailstab:OptionDescriptionAccept & EditAcceptClick 1 of these buttons to accept the rule and add it to a matching rule set. Workday:
- Prompts you to select a matching rule set to add the rule to.
- Adds the rule last in the rule set.
When you clickAccept & Edit, Workday displays theEdit Matching Rule Settask to enable you to edit and reorder the rule. Example: You accept the rule and rename it.RejectClick this button to document your review of the rule and change its status toRejected.You can still access the rule from theBank Reconciliation AI Rules Audit Logreport.
